Subject: Cams/Roller Rockers/Viper Rockers
IP: Logged

Message:
It may be obvious, but I'm kinda confused as to what exactly the three above are and what there differences are. I think with roller rockers and Viper rockers, you can only use one or the other, but how about with cams? Which one would be the most price efficient (most bang for the buck)? And what would be avg price for each? If engine matters, I have a 98 3.9V6, with about 14xxxx mi.
Thanks, any info is greatly appreiciated

you dont want to use 1.7 ratio rocker arms
roller or standard with a larger cam

possible valve to piston clearance issues

if your on a low budget for mods
then the viper rockers are the way to go

have a larger budget
then 1.6 roller rockers and a larger cam
would show the most hp & trq. gains

does that help?

You can use 1.7 rockers (roller or not) with an aftermarket cam. It's just you need to advise the vendor that you're using 1.7 rockers so they can grind the lobes accordingly to avoid possible valve/piston clearance issues. I'm using 1.7 rockers on custom ground cam. IMO, a custom cam will give you the biggest band for your dollar. However, new valve springs will need to be installed as well. Good luck!
